Typically, an equipment loan is secured by the equipment being financed. This means that if you take out a loan to purchase a piece of equipment, that equipment will serve as collateral for the loan until it is paid off. However, we also offer an equipment line of credit that does not require security over the equipment purchased. Equipment finance is a type of loan that provides you with the necessary funds to purchase the equipment your business requires. The lender will hold the equipment as collateral until the loan is fully paid off. This type of financing can be used for a variety of purposes, including buying new or used equipment, refinancing existing equipment, and expanding business operations to generate additional revenue.

There are both advantages and disadvantages to financing equipment.

Advantages of equipment financing include:

  • Maintaining cash flow: Financing equipment means you can acquire the equipment you need without having to pay for it all upfront. This helps preserve cash flow, which can be used for other important business expenses.
  • Expanding operations: Equipment financing can help you grow your business by providing you with the funds to purchase equipment needed for expansion.
  • Keeping up with new technologies: Financing equipment allows you to keep up with the latest technologies and stay competitive in your industry.
  • Tax benefits: Equipment financing may offer tax benefits such as deducting the interest on your loan repayments and depreciation of the equipment.
  • Keeping working capital in the business: Financing equipment means you can keep your working capital in the business, rather than tying it up in equipment purchases.

Disadvantages of equipment financing include:

  • You don’t own the equipment outright: Until you pay off the loan, the lender has a claim on the equipment. If you default on your payments, the lender may repossess the equipment.
  • Interest, fees, and charges: When financing equipment, you will have to pay interest on the loan, as well as any fees and charges associated with the loan. This can add up to a significant amount over time.

Although the interest rate is a crucial factor that determines your repayment amount and the total interest you will pay, it is not the only consideration when taking out business finance. You should also consider other aspects such as fees and charges, loan term, early repayment fees, loan type, security requirements, and consequences of missed payments. These factors can have tax or other impacts on your business, so it is essential to understand them before taking out a business loan.
